A modifier model is that APOE4 reactive-state signaling, potentially through NF-kB or mTORC1-linked programs, increases SREBP2 activity even when sterol trafficking is not the sole lesion. This is best treated as an amplifier or combination axis rather than the primary explanation for SCAP-SREBP2 dysregulation.
The strongest synthesis is an indirect mechanism in glia: APOE4 promotes cholesterol sequestration in late endosome/lysosome compartments, lowering the ER-accessible cholesterol pool sensed by SCAP despite normal or elevated total cellular cholesterol. This weakens SCAP-INSIG retention, increases SREBP2 processing, and may explain the paradox of cholesterol accumulation alongside increased cholesterol biosynthesis.
